Ultravana Period Pain Relief 250mg Gastro-resistant Tablets provide effective relief from primary period pain (dysmenorrhoea) in women aged 15 to 50 years. Each gastro-resistant tablet contains naproxen 250mg, a non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drug (NSAID) that helps relieve menstrual cramps by reducing the production of prostaglandins, the substances responsible for pain and inflammation during menstruation. The gastro-resistant coating helps the tablet pass through the stomach before dissolving in the intestine.

Directions for Use
- Suitable for women aged 15 to 50 years.
- Start taking the tablets as soon as period pain begins.
- Day 1: Take 2 tablets (500mg) initially, then 1 tablet after 6 to 8 hours if required.
- Days 2 and 3: If needed, take 1 tablet every 6 to 8 hours.
- Do not take more than 3 tablets in 24 hours.
- Do not use for more than 3 days during any one menstrual cycle.
- Swallow the tablets whole with water, preferably with or after food. Do not crush or chew the tablets.

Why should I start taking it when the pain begins?
Naproxen works by reducing prostaglandins, which are responsible for menstrual cramps. Taking it as soon as symptoms begin helps control pain before it becomes more severe.
Can I take Ultravana with paracetamol?
Yes. Paracetamol can generally be taken alongside naproxen if additional pain relief is required, provided both medicines are used according to their dosing instructions. If you are unsure, consult your pharmacist or doctor.
Can I take Ultravana every month?
Yes. Ultravana can be used during each menstrual cycle when needed, but it should not be used for more than 3 consecutive days during any one period unless advised by a healthcare professional.
